About David J. Whellan

David J. Whellan is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Complementary and alternative medicine, Family Practice, Geriatrics and Gerontology and Emergency Medicine, having authored 249 papers that have together received 14.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Heart Failure Treatment and Management (151 papers), Cardiovascular Function and Risk Factors (71 papers), Cardiovascular and exercise physiology (59 papers), Cardiac pacing and defibrillation studies (52 papers), Cardiac Health and Mental Health (36 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(18 papers), Cardiovascular Effects of Exercise (14 papers) and Frailty in Older Adults (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(10.3k citations), Complementary and alternative medicine (2.6k citations), Family Practice (613 citations), Geriatrics and Gerontology (969 citations) and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(1.1k citations). David J. Whellan has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Christopher M. O’Connor, Dalane W. Kitzman, Ileana L. Piña, Kevin A. Schulman, William E. Kraus, Steven J. Keteyian, Karen E. Joynt, Stephen J. Ellis, G. Michael Felker and Eric Leifer. Their work appears in journals such as American Heart Journal, Journal of Cardiac Failure, Journal of the American College of Cardiology, The American Journal of Cardiology and JACC Heart Failure.
